Developed and maintained automated test scripts using Selenium WebDriver and TestNG to support functional and regression testing of web applications
Collaborated with developers and business analysts to understand requirements and create comprehensive test scenarios and test cases
Implemented BDD (Behavior-Driven Development) using Cucumber for writing feature files and step definitions to enhance test automation efficiency and readability
Integrated automated tests into Continuous Integration pipelines using Jenkins, ensuring early detection of defects and timely feedback to developers
Participated in daily stand-up meetings, sprint planning, and retrospective sessions as part of Agile development team
Identified, documented, and tracked software defects using Jira, facilitating communication and resolution between development and QA teams
Conducted performance testing using Pycharm to evaluate the scalability and responsiveness of web applications under different load conditions.
Streamlined communication between developers and testers, fostering a collaborative working environment that emphasized shared goals and objectives.
Built automated test scripts to handle repetitive software testing work.
Documented testing procedures for developers and future testing use.
Optimized test coverage by prioritizing high-risk areas of the application, using risk-based testing methodologies.
Monitored resolution of bugs, tested fixes, and helped developers tackle ongoing problems by providing QA perspective.
Automation Tester Intern
Relgo Networks Pvt Ltd
03.2018 - 04.2021
Assisted in the development of automated test scripts for web applications using Selenium WebDriver and Python
Executed automated test suites and analyzed test results to identify defects and verify system functionality
Collaborated with senior testers to create and maintain test documentation, including test plans, test cases, and test reports
Collaborated with product owners to stay current on intended functionality.
Authored and maintained well-organized, efficient and successful manual test cases for entire team.
Discussed requirements and processes with project managers and developers.
Participated in code reviews and contributed to the improvement of test automation frameworks and processes.
Created successful test scripts to manage automated feature testing
Updated and maintained project documentation for detailed recordkeeping.
Reduced manual testing efforts with the development of reusable automated test scripts.
Assessed software bugs and compiled findings along with suggested resolutions for development team members.